Output 51e8566c1cb403a437cc72f56092fef121401348fd5d2fcdf9ff45966f0e8605:0
- value
- 345264628
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8a96a73308ccc3b0316853b110ca04e4cc01f1d
- address
- bc1qmz5k5ues3nxrkqcks5a3zr9qfexvq8cahq4pvz
- transaction
- 51e8566c1cb403a437cc72f56092fef121401348fd5d2fcdf9ff45966f0e8605